DTx Digital Transistors
ROHM DTx Digital Transistors are available in PNP and NPN configurations. These transistors feature built-in bias resistors which enable the configuration of an inverter circuit without external input resistors. Only the on/off conditions need to be set for the operation which makes the circuit design easy. The DTx transistors are available in a variety of packages (reel type/taping type). The DTx digital transistors are ideal for inverters, interface, and drivers.
